Isumi Railway Urged to Improve Track Maintenance after Derailment

Tokyo, Oct. 2 (Jiji Press)–The Japan Transport Safety Board on Thursday urged Isumi Railway in Chiba Prefecture, east of Tokyo, to improve its track maintenance system after a derailment incident last year.
